The tools referenced represent a category of applications designed to streamline and enhance the operational efficiency of professionals who assess residential properties. These applications frequently incorporate features such as report generation, scheduling, client management, and data storage capabilities tailored to the specific demands of property evaluation. As an illustration, a property assessor might leverage such a solution to generate detailed reports including photographic evidence and deficiency notations directly on-site, reducing administrative overhead.

Adopting digital solutions for property assessments delivers several advantages. These include improved report accuracy and consistency, expedited report delivery to clients, and enhanced data management capabilities for tracking inspection history and identifying trends. Historically, property evaluators relied on manual processes involving paper checklists and handwritten notes. The introduction of specialized applications signifies a shift towards automated workflows, facilitating faster turnaround times and enhanced client satisfaction. The advantages extend to reduced errors, centralized data storage, and improved overall business management.

2. Scheduling Integration

Scheduling integration, within the context of property assessment software, directly impacts operational efficiency and client management. Its presence or absence significantly influences a property evaluator’s ability to manage appointments, coordinate resources, and maintain client communication effectively.

  • Automated Appointment Management

    Automated appointment management replaces manual scheduling processes with a digital interface. This functionality allows clients to request appointments online, which are then automatically integrated into the evaluator’s calendar. The system can also send automated reminders to both the evaluator and the client, reducing the likelihood of missed appointments. Example: A property evaluator can set up a system where clients book appointments directly through a website, and the system automatically updates the evaluator’s schedule while sending confirmation emails and text reminders. This streamlines the booking process and minimizes administrative overhead.

  • Resource Allocation

    Effective scheduling integration facilitates optimal resource allocation. The software can track evaluator availability, equipment requirements, and travel distances, enabling efficient assignment of evaluators to specific jobs. This ensures that the most appropriate personnel are assigned to each task, minimizing travel time and maximizing productivity. Example: A large property evaluation firm can use integrated scheduling to assign evaluators with specific expertise to properties requiring specialized assessments, ensuring that the right expertise is deployed efficiently.

  • Client Communication

    Integrated scheduling solutions often include automated communication features. These enable property evaluators to send appointment confirmations, pre-evaluation checklists, and post-evaluation follow-up messages automatically. This proactive communication enhances the client experience and reduces the need for manual follow-up. Example: After a client schedules an evaluation, the system automatically sends a confirmation email with details about the appointment, a checklist of items to prepare, and contact information for the evaluator. This enhances client satisfaction by providing clear expectations and immediate support.

  • Conflict Resolution

    A robust scheduling system identifies and resolves potential scheduling conflicts. It prevents double-booking, accounts for travel time between appointments, and flags overlapping commitments. This feature is critical for maintaining operational efficiency and preventing logistical errors. Example: The system flags a potential conflict when an evaluator attempts to schedule two evaluations at locations that are geographically distant within a short time frame, prompting the scheduler to adjust the schedule and prevent logistical issues.

These facets demonstrate that scheduling integration is not merely a convenience but a critical component of effective property assessment software. Systems lacking robust scheduling capabilities can lead to inefficiencies, communication breakdowns, and scheduling errors, undermining the overall value of the digital tool. Consequently, thorough evaluation of scheduling functionalities is paramount when selecting a suitable solution.

3. Mobile Accessibility

Mobile accessibility is a defining characteristic of leading property evaluation software solutions. It dictates the extent to which an evaluator can efficiently utilize the application while conducting field assessments, directly influencing data collection accuracy, report generation speed, and overall workflow effectiveness.

  • On-Site Data Entry

    Mobile accessibility allows for direct data input during the assessment process. Rather than relying on handwritten notes and subsequent transcription, evaluators can record observations, measurements, and photographic evidence directly into the software via a mobile device. This reduces the potential for errors, streamlines data processing, and accelerates report generation. Example: An evaluator can use a tablet to record the dimensions of a room, note the condition of fixtures, and capture supporting photographs, all while physically present in the space. This data is then immediately available for inclusion in the final report.

  • Offline Functionality

    Reliable mobile solutions offer offline functionality, enabling evaluators to continue working in areas with limited or no internet connectivity. This is crucial for assessments conducted in rural or remote locations where access to a network is not guaranteed. Data collected offline is synchronized with the cloud once a connection is re-established. Example: An evaluator inspecting a property in a remote area with unreliable cellular service can still complete the assessment, recording all relevant data. Once the evaluator returns to an area with internet access, the data is automatically uploaded and synchronized with the main system.

  • Real-Time Collaboration

    Some mobile applications facilitate real-time collaboration between evaluators in the field and support staff in the office. This allows for immediate consultation on complex issues, remote guidance, and collaborative report review. Example: An evaluator encountering an unusual structural anomaly can share photographs and data with a senior engineer in the office for immediate feedback and guidance. This enables faster decision-making and reduces the need for repeat site visits.

  • Mobile Report Generation

    The capability to generate preliminary reports directly from a mobile device represents a significant advantage. It enables evaluators to provide clients with initial findings and recommendations immediately after the assessment, enhancing client satisfaction and facilitating faster decision-making. Example: After completing a property evaluation, an evaluator can generate a summary report directly from their tablet and email it to the client while still on-site. This provides the client with immediate insights and reinforces the evaluator’s professionalism.

These aspects illustrate the pivotal role of mobile accessibility in optimizing the property evaluation process. Solutions lacking robust mobile capabilities limit an evaluator’s efficiency, increase the potential for errors, and diminish client satisfaction. Therefore, prioritizing applications with comprehensive mobile features is paramount when seeking a superior property assessment tool. 4. Data Security

Data security is a non-negotiable attribute of superior property evaluation software. The connection between data security and the classification as a leading solution is causal: inadequate data protection directly undermines an application’s viability, regardless of other features. The criticality stems from the sensitive nature of the information handled, including client contact details, property addresses, structural assessments, and financial data. A breach in security can expose this information to unauthorized access, leading to legal liabilities, reputational damage, and financial losses for both the evaluator and the client. For instance, imagine a scenario where a property evaluation firm experiences a data breach, and client addresses and property details are compromised. This could result in identity theft, targeted burglaries, and erosion of client trust, ultimately jeopardizing the firm’s long-term sustainability.

Effective data security measures within property evaluation software encompass multiple layers of protection. These include robust encryption protocols for data at rest and in transit, stringent access controls to limit unauthorized user access, regular security audits to identify and address vulnerabilities, and adherence to relevant data privacy regulations such as GDPR or CCPA. Consider the practical application of encryption. If a software uses end-to-end encryption, even if unauthorized access occurs, the data remains unintelligible without the decryption key, which is held securely. Similarly, multi-factor authentication adds an extra layer of security by requiring users to provide multiple forms of identification, preventing unauthorized access even if a password is compromised.

6. Pricing Structure

The pricing structure of property evaluation software exerts a direct influence on its accessibility and, consequently, its potential to be classified among the “best.” The relationship is complex, involving cost-benefit analysis, perceived value, and budgetary constraints. An excessively high price point, irrespective of feature richness, can preclude adoption by independent evaluators or small firms, thereby limiting market penetration and hindering widespread recognition as a leading solution. Conversely, a price that is too low may raise concerns about the software’s quality, reliability, or the level of support provided. For example, a subscription model offering unlimited reports and comprehensive support for a nominal fee might be viewed skeptically due to concerns about data security or the long-term viability of the provider. The practical significance lies in the fact that a balanced pricing strategy is crucial for achieving market equilibrium and attracting a broad user base.

Practical applications of pricing structures vary significantly. Some providers offer tiered pricing, allowing users to select plans based on the number of evaluations conducted per month or the level of features required. Others employ a per-report fee structure, charging users only for the evaluations they complete. Subscription models often include ongoing updates, customer support, and data storage, while per-report fees may require additional payments for these services. A tiered model, for instance, might offer a “basic” plan suitable for part-time evaluators and a “premium” plan designed for larger firms requiring advanced features and dedicated support. A “best” solution aligns its pricing with the needs and capabilities of its target market. Transparency in pricing is also a determining factor. Hidden fees or unexpected charges can erode user trust and diminish the perceived value of the software, regardless of its technical merits.

8. Integration Capabilities

Integration capabilities, within the context of property evaluation software, represent a critical factor influencing operational efficiency and data management effectiveness. The connection between robust integration and recognition as a leading solution stems from the necessity for seamless data exchange with complementary systems. Property evaluation does not occur in isolation; it necessitates interaction with accounting software, client relationship management (CRM) platforms, scheduling applications, and potentially, government databases for permit verification or regulatory compliance. Software lacking comprehensive integration capabilities creates data silos, necessitates manual data entry across multiple platforms, and increases the likelihood of errors. For example, a property evaluator who must manually transfer client information from a CRM system to the evaluation software and then again to an accounting system for invoicing experiences significant inefficiencies and potential for data discrepancies. This detracts from the evaluator’s ability to focus on core assessment activities, directly impacting productivity and client satisfaction.

Effective integration manifests in several forms. API (Application Programming Interface) integration enables real-time data exchange between the evaluation software and other platforms. Webhooks allow the software to trigger actions in other systems based on specific events, such as the completion of an evaluation report. Direct integrations with popular accounting software like QuickBooks or Xero streamline invoicing and financial management. Calendar synchronization with applications like Google Calendar or Outlook ensures accurate scheduling and reduces the risk of scheduling conflicts. Consider a scenario where a property evaluation is completed, and the software automatically generates an invoice in the accounting system, updates the client’s record in the CRM, and sends a notification to the client via email. This level of automation minimizes administrative overhead, improves data accuracy, and enhances the client experience. 9. Compliance Standards

The ability of property evaluation software to adhere to prevailing compliance standards directly impacts its classification as a leading solution. This connection is causal: failure to comply with relevant regulations exposes users to legal liabilities, financial penalties, and reputational damage, irrespective of other software features. The importance stems from the sensitive nature of property evaluations, which often involve the collection, storage, and transmission of personal and confidential information. Additionally, specific industries, such as those dealing with federally-insured mortgages or environmental assessments, are subject to strict reporting requirements and data security protocols. For example, software utilized for conducting evaluations related to FHA-insured loans must adhere to specific guidelines regarding data collection, report formatting, and electronic signature protocols. A software provider that fails to incorporate these compliance standards into its design risks disqualifying its product from use in a significant segment of the market. Understanding this practical significance is crucial, as it dictates the long-term viability and market acceptance of any property evaluation software.

Practical application of compliance standards within property evaluation software extends to several key areas. Data encryption protocols, adherence to privacy regulations like GDPR or CCPA, secure data storage, and audit trails are all essential components. Consider a software solution operating within the European Union. It must implement measures to ensure that client data is processed in accordance with GDPR guidelines, including obtaining explicit consent for data collection, providing mechanisms for data access and deletion, and implementing robust security measures to prevent data breaches. Failure to comply with these regulations can result in substantial fines and reputational damage. Similarly, in the United States, software handling personal health information (PHI) related to environmental hazards or lead paint assessments must comply with HIPAA regulations. These examples highlight the need for proactive and comprehensive compliance management within property evaluation software.
